PHP與MySQL是Web開發中最常用的編程語言和數據庫。它們的結合能夠實現強大的Web應用程序。本文將從入門到精通地介紹PHP與MySQL的完美結合,幫助讀者掌握這一技術。
1. PHP和MySQL的介紹
PHP是一種服務器端腳本語言,它可以在服務器上運行,生成動態的Web頁面。MySQL是一種關系型數據庫,用于存儲和管理數據。PHP和MySQL的結合可以實現動態的Web應用程序。
2. PHP和MySQL的安裝
要使用PHP和MySQL,需要在本地計算機上安裝它們。可以使用XAMPP或WAMP等集成軟件包來安裝它們。安裝完成后,可以通過localhost訪問PHP和MySQL。
3. 連接MySQL數據庫
ysqli或PDO等擴展來連接MySQL數據庫。連接過程包括指定主機名、用戶名、密碼和數據庫名等信息。
4. 執行MySQL查詢
ysqliysqli_fetch_array或PDO::fetch等函數獲取。
5. PHP和MySQL的CRUD操作
ysqli或PDO等擴展來執行這些操作。
6. PHP和MySQL的安全性
ysqli或PDO等擴展來防止SQL注入攻擊。還可以使用密碼哈希等技術來保護用戶密碼。
7. PHP和MySQL的性能優化
在使用PHP和MySQL時,需要注意性能優化。可以使用索引、緩存等技術來提高查詢性能。還可以使用連接池等技術來提高連接性能。
PHP和MySQL的完美結合可以實現強大的Web應用程序。本文介紹了PHP和MySQL的基本知識、安裝、連接、查詢、CRUD操作、安全性和性能優化等方面。希望讀者通過本文的學習,掌握PHP和MySQL的完美結合技術。